Spring brings pink buds that open to white very fragrant blooms. Autumn brings a display of bright red foliage. Vigorous growth habit. Deer resistant and shade tolerant. Trim to shape after flowering. Attracts birds and pollinators.
                      Botanical Name- Viburnum carlesii 'Spiro'
                    
                      Pronunciation- vy-BUR-num karl-EE-see-eye
                    
                      Foliage- Deciduous

                      Yearly Care Instructions- Prune after flowering to maintain shape. Needs moderate watering and well-drained soil. A balanced fertilizer in spring helps produce fragrant blooms.
                    
                      Trimming Instructions- Prune right after flowering, removing spent blooms and shaping lightly. Avoid heavy cuts to preserve next year's buds.
                    
                      Fertilization Instructions- Use a balanced fertilizer (e.g., 14-14-14) in early spring; moderate feeding need. In clay, add organic matter to improve root development and flowering.
                    
                      Fertilizer Recommendation- Plant-tone
                    
                      Possible Issues- Viburnum leaf beetle, aphids
